Historically, AnonyTun was famously used to access free internet ("tunneling") via specific proxy configurations. While those loopholes have largely been patched by network providers, AnonyTun remains a viable tool for —masking your IP address and encrypting traffic.

Network congestion or a stale IP address can prevent authentication. Turn on Airplane Mode for 10 seconds, turn it off, wait for the MTN data signal to stabilize, and try connecting again. 2. Change the Server Location
